The playoffs for the Stanley Cup in 1953 began on March 24, 1953 and ended on April 16, 1953 with the 4-1 victory of the Canadiens de Montréal against the Boston Bruins . In their third finals in a row, the Canadiens won their first title since 1946 and their seventh in franchise history . The Boston Bruins, meanwhile, played their first final since 1946, in which they were defeated Montréal with the same final score of 1: 4. In addition, Boston was the top scorer of these playoffs in the person of Ed Sandford .
mode
The four best teams in the league qualified for the playoffs. In the semi-finals, the first and third as well as the second and fourth of the final table faced each other. The respective winners then contested the Stanley Cup final.
All series were held in best-of-seven mode , which means that a team needed four wins to advance. The higher seeded team had home rights in the first two games, the next two the opposing team. If no winner has emerged from the round by then, the home law changed from game to game. The higher-ranked team had a home advantage in games 1, 2, 5 and 7, i.e. four of the maximum seven games.
Overtime followed for games that remained tied after 60 minutes of regular playing time . It ended with the first goal scored ( Sudden Death ) .
